Character from Breaking Bad by Vince Gilligan
The most volatile drug distributor in the Southwest — a man who beats his own associates to death for speaking out of turn and screams 'TIGHT TIGHT TIGHT!' when the product is good.
Tuco Salamanca is what happens when cartel bloodline meets crystal meth addiction. He is Walt and Jesse's first major distributor, and their introduction to the reality that the drug trade is not a business negotiation — it's a survival scenario. He beat his associate No-Doze to death in front of Walt and Jesse for the crime of speaking without permission. His signature moment — tasting Walt's product and screaming 'TIGHT TIGHT TIGHT! Blue, yellow, pink — whatever, man, just keep bringing me that!' — captures his essence: genuine enthusiasm expressed through a personality disorder. He kidnapped Walt and Jesse to his desert hideout and was killed by Hank in a shootout. Even his death was chaotic.
Wiry, intense, with darting eyes and the energy of a live wire dipped in methamphetamine. Gold teeth. Constant motion. He vibrates with barely contained violence even when he's happy — especially when he's happy.
